Understanding Metal Finishes

Metal finishes can vary widely in terms of color, texture, and sheen. They provide an opportunity to incorporate personal style while also adhering to practical needs. Common metal finishes used in kitchens include:

  • Stainless Steel: A popular choice known for its modern appeal and resistance to rust and corrosion.

  • Brass: This warm metal finish adds a touch of elegance and vintage charm.

  • Copper: Known for its rich color and ability to develop a unique patina over time.

  • Matte Black: A contemporary finish that offers a sleek and bold contrast in kitchen designs.


Creating a Cohesive Look

When integrating various metal finishes, it’s essential to create a cohesive look. Here are some practical ways to do this:

  • Limit to Three Finishes: To maintain balance, choose a maximum of three different metal finishes. This helps create a layered look without overwhelming the space.

  • Match Functionality: Consider the function of the metals you choose. Stainless steel is great for appliances due to its durability, while brass fixtures can elevate areas where aesthetics are key.

  • Use Contrast Wisely: Mixing warm tones like brass with cool tones like stainless steel can provide an interesting visual contrast that enhances the overall aesthetic.


Enhancing Key Features

Incorporating different metal finishes should not only focus on aesthetic appeal but also enhance key features in your kitchen:

1. Cabinet Hardware

Using contrasting metals for cabinet handles and knobs can create a focal point in your kitchen. For example, pairing matte black handles with brass cabinetry can create a stunning impact. At Design with Moxie, we’ve seen how thoughtful hardware choices can breathe life into outdated cabinetry.

2. Sink and Faucet

The sink and faucet area is another significant aspect where metal finishes come into play. A brass faucet over a stainless steel sink can add a touch of luxury without compromising functionality. Ensure that the finishes used in this area harmonize with the rest of the kitchen’s metal elements to avoid clashes.

3. Light Fixtures

Light fixtures are a perfect opportunity to introduce unique metal finishes. Consider using copper or brass fixtures that not only provide illumination but also enhance the room's decor. This is a great way to blend industrial style with elegance, creating an inviting atmosphere for cooking or entertaining.


Maintaining Metal Finishes

Different metals require varying levels of maintenance. Here are some tips for keeping those finishes looking their best:

  • Stainless Steel: Clean with a soft cloth and stainless steel cleaner to maintain its sheen.

  • Brass: Regular polishing is necessary to prevent tarnishing and maintain its warm glow.

  • Copper: To retain its unique coloration, consider applying a protective coating or lacquer.

  • Matte Black: Wipe with a damp cloth to avoid scratching the surface and to maintain its sleek appearance.
